Anyone can own properly vetted deer and turkeys if they are tagged with the policyholder`s full name, address, pick-up date, and Telecheck confirmation number. The Telecheck confirmation number must remain affixed to the carcass until a meat processor begins processing the animal. Anyone who finds a dead deer with antlers still attached to the skull plate can take the antlers, but must report the discovery to a conservation officer within 24 hours to get permission to own the antlers. At any other time, you must have a full or unfilled deer hunting license to help others collect deer, including participating in deer walks or attracting deer with clattering screams or antlers. You must have a completed or uncompleted turkey hunting licence to help others take turkeys, including making phone calls. It is illegal to shoot a deer or turkey for another hunter. Group hunting, where hunters pool their licences, is prohibited. Woodless archery permits can be used in open counties during archery season. Boundaries vary by county. „Chronic wasting disease has the potential to have a significant impact on the Missouri deer herd,“ said Jason L. Isabelle, Cervid Program Supervisor and wildlife biologist certified by the Missouri Department of Conservation Board of Trustees. CWD was first detected in the free-ranging deer population in 2012 and has now been found in 18 Missouri counties.
